A few nights ago, some sort of predator got into the coop and killed one of my two chickens. I'm am completely heartbroken and i'm now so paranoid that something will get in again. I have reinforced the run/coop but i'm still really nervous. I have been setting traps every night and in the morning, the food is gone and the trap is sprung but there is nothing inside. I don't know what to do :(
 
Also, the other chicken had a small bloody scab right above the beak.. what should I do to make sure she doesn't get it infected or get a disease from whatever predator it was?
 
It is scabbed over but I will put hydrogen peroxide and neosporin on it as soon as I get home from work today.
 
Clean the wound with hydrogen peroxide, put some iodine, or antiseptic cream on it.

Half strength hydrogen peroxide, please, and only for the initial cleansing. Peroxide does some really awful stuff to healthy tissue, especially with continued use.
 
The attack happened 2 nights ago. It is completely scabbed over... is it too late for the hydrogen peroxide? should I just apply neosporin?
